so was that JLA story basically the conclusion to Conway's New Gods revival?


That JLA story in 184-185 by Conway/Perez/McLaughlin was unrelated to the Conway/Newton run in NEW GODS. It was just basically the
JLA/JSA annual crossover, in a team-up with the New Gods. who travel to Apokalips to share one adventure together.
(Part 1 in issue 183 was penciled by Dick Dillin who died suddenly, so Perez was called in to do art on parts 2 and 3).

The revived NEW GODS 12-19 run by Conway/Newton (which was cancelled with the DC Implosion) was concluded somewhat unsatisfyingly in ADVENTURE 459-460 by the same Conway/Newton creative team.

One issue I enjoyed was the one-shot that preceded the Conway Newton run that revived the NEW GODS, in FIRST ISSUE SPECIAL 13, by Dennis O'Neil and Mike Vosburg. Nice to see O'Neil's interpretation of the Fourth World characters, with Mike Vosburg art that was
consistent with the Kirby run on the series. Far more so than the then-soon-to-come Conway/Newton run.


The most true to Kirby of that period was the Englehart/Rogers MISTER MIRACLE run in issues 19-22, and the Gerber/Golden run in issues 23-25 (which like the Conway/Newton NEW GODS, was cancelled due to the DC Implosion).
